Admission Process for MBBS in Uzbekistan
The admission process for MBBS in Uzbekistan is straightforward, especially when guided by experts like The MD House. Here is a step-by-step overview:
- Eligibility Criteria:
- Completion of 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ology as core subjects.
- A minimum of 50% marks in aggregate (40% for reserved categories).
- NEET qualification is mandatory for Indian students.
- Application Process:
- Choose your desired university and submit the application form along with the required documents.
- Provide scanned copies of your academic certificates, passport, and recent photographs.
- Admission Letter: Upon approval, the university will issue an admission letter.
- Visa Application: Apply for a student visa with the help of your admission letter and other necessary documents.
- Travel and Enrollment: Once your visa is approved, book your travel and complete the enrollment process at the university.

Cost of Living in Uzbekistan
One of the significant advantages of studying in Uzbekistan is its low cost of living. Here’s an estimate of monthly expenses:
- Accommodation: $100 – $150
- Food: $50 – $100
- Transportation: $10 – $20
- Miscellaneous: $30 – $50
